Global streaming service DAZN has reached an agreement with French soccer’s LFP organizing body to terminate their domestic broadcast contract for the top-flight Ligue 1 - after just one season.

In February, DAZN defaulted on their monthly payment due to a dispute with the LFP. The broadcaster withheld €35 million (which was later paid) due to be distributed to Ligue 1 clubs.

Ligue 1 clubs in France are to pull out of their domestic television rights deal with DAZN. The broadcaster has rejected a proposal from the Ligue after a breakdown in relations between the two sides.
